Student Equipment Grant 2011 Winners

Jasper Donker of Utrecht University and Evely Aparicio of Deltares are the winners of the first and second price.

The winner of the first price of the Student Equipment Grant is Jasper Donker. Jasper is working on his PhD at the University of Utrecht under supervision of Dr. Gerben Ruessink. They will use both an AWAC wave and current profiler and an Aquadopp HR Profiler for experiments near shore at Egmond with a focus on long waves. Jasper will also use an Aquadopp HR Profiler for studies of wave damping and sediment mixing over mussel beds. The first price is the use of an instrument during three months and a travel budget of € 1.000 to present results at a scientific conference.
 
The winner of the second price is Evelyn Aparicio. Evelyn is working on her PhD at Deltares and the University of Eindhoven under supervision of Dr. Rob Uittenbogaard. Evelyn is trying to measure turbulent flows in the near proximity of bubbles plumes. The first part of these experiments are performed to find the best instrument to use under these difficult conditions with many bubbles, acoustic noise and high variability of currents. The second part is to actually perform the measurements The second price is the use of an instrument during a period of some two months.
 
With the Student Equipment Grant we make available instruments which would otherwise maybe not accesible for graduate and PhD students. We honour especially innovative and challenging measurement applications
